The most questions we’ve been asked will be answered below:

Q: Where did you stay?

A: An AirBnb! The Tenor at Harmony Nashville. (It has a rooftop deck where we took all of our photos!) Absolutely LOVED our experience there.

Q: What club did you guys go to?

A: The β€œclub” seen in the TikTok video is the Jason Aldean Bar (4th floor). It turns into a more club/nightlife scene on the weekends. SO much fun, especially at night. Also recommend a party bus/tour! We did that the first night at sunset. Also went to Luke Bryan’s Bar during the day.

Q: Best places to eat?

A: We went with the flow when it came to places to eat. One of the days I remember going to Acme Feed & Seed which is a really great place to go if you want brunch on Broadway. We also tried to get reservations to Miranda Lambert’s Bar, Casa Rosa, but it took a while! This is where the pretty yellow flower wall is. Also, I recommend checking out these places… they’re a MUST if you can get reservations or have time: The Hampton Social // Pinewood Social // The Ainsworth (for bottomless mimosas!!) // RH Nashville (for a dressier experience) // and of course, Dolly Parton’s White Limozeen for a whole experience (book way ahead for this!)
